Type 1 vs Type 2 Explained

SAE J1772 (Type 1) and Mennekes (Type 2) are the main global standards. Type 1, also known as SAE J1772, is North American standard, while Type 2, or Mennekes, is the standard in Europe. The right cable matches your car and charger. Type 2 cables often support higher charging capacities, making them ideal for speed.

Level 2 & Fast DC Cables

Level 2 AC cables charge faster, up to 19.2 kW. DC Fast Charging cables, on the other hand, enable quick top-ups by on-site AC→DC conversion, allowing for much faster charging times. These cables are key for highway charging, enabling drivers to recharge quickly.

Portable vs Fixed Cables

Portable EV charging cables, such as “Granny chargers,” offer flexibility by allowing owners to charge their vehicles from standard household outlets. Tethered cables are attached permanently, providing a convenient but less flexible charging solution. The choice comes down to flexibility vs convenience.

Certified Safety and Standards

Safety certifications and compliance with international standards are non-negotiable for reputable EV charging cable manufacturers. They ensure their products meet or exceed standards such as IEC62196 for connectors and UL2594 in North America. Rigorous third-party testing evaluates electrical safety, mechanical durability, and environmental resistance.

Certification Description Region
IEC62196 Connector safety standards International
UL2594 Standard for electric vehicle supply equipment North America
ROHS Restriction of hazardous substances International

How to Select the Right EV Charging Cable for Your Vehicle

Choosing the right EV charging cable is crucial for efficient and safe charging. To make an informed decision, consider several key factors.

Connector Compatibility

Ensure the charging cable is compatible with your vehicle’s connector type. Your vehicle’s onboard charger capacity determines the maximum AC charging rate it can accept.

Picking the Right Cable Length

Choose a cable length that suits your charging needs. A longer cable adds reach at the cost of extra weight.

Matching Power and Speed

Match your cable’s power handling to your vehicle’s capabilities. Standard Level 2 home charging operates at 7.2 kW, but some vehicles support up to 19.2 kW with appropriate electrical service.
